The new record for Sunday: Electricity at heights – Energy

In the midst of a heat wave affecting the entire Iberian Peninsula and with an increase in energy consumption, the values ​​​​traded in the wholesale market on Sunday 15 August will rise to 110.02 euros per megawatt-hour. amount will be 4% is down from 114.63 MWh this Saturday, but still at a historic value on Sunday, according to data from OMIE, the Iberian energy market operator cited by El País.

When analyzing prices by time periods, Mw/h will range between €124.91. Electricity will cost between midnight and 01:00 and €84.97 for the period between 18:00 and 20:00.

In fact, the price will decrease in the wholesale market for the second day in a row, but the adjustments are very small compared to the increases recorded over the past few weeks. On the last two Sundays of August, electricity was traded on the wholesale market at values ​​of about 80 euros per megawatt-hour, while in July, Sundays recorded prices in the range of 80-90 euros per megawatt-hour.

One of the factors driving up electricity prices is the heat wave in the Iberian Peninsula. But the prices of natural gas used to produce electricity are also rising. The price at which CO licenses are traded has also put pressure on the wholesale electricity market.

In monthly terms, July was the most expensive ever: the Iberian Mibel electricity market ended this month with an average price of 92.60 euros per megawatt-hour.
